Abstract

475,059. Electrolytic production of hyposulphites. I. G. FARBENINDUSTRIE AKT.-GES. May 11, 1936, No. 13360. Convention date, May 10, 1935. [Class 41] Hyposulphites are obtained by cathodic reduction of bisulphite-containing solutions using cathodes of thin wires preferably of diameter less than 2 mm. e.g. 0À1-0À5 mm. along which the catholyte is moved, the wires being spaced apart preferably at intervals more than 0À5 mm.; the electrolyte is agitated by introduction of an inert gas such as carbon dioxide, hydrogen or nitrogen. The current should be greater than 1 amp., preferably 5-50 amps., per 100 cc. of catholyte. Specification 475,060 is referred to.
